[Biojava-l] Mutable Features - strand?

Matthew Pocock matthew_pocock at yahoo.co.uk
Mon Jun 30 09:25:36 EDT 2003


Hi,

This is an oversight. We should add the interface method:

    void setStrand(Strand) throws ChangeVetoException

Any volunteeres?

Matthew

Keith James wrote:
> I'm wondering about mutating Features - someone here using biojava has
> pointed out that while most properties of generic features are now
> mutable (type, type term, location, source etc), strand is not.
> 
> While there is a 'flip' method on Strand, there is no way to apply the
> flipped Strand back to a feature. Is this an oversight, or is there a
> reason why StrandedFeature has this immutable property?
> 
> The reason it is requested is for GUI tools where features need to get
> bumped around and generally messed with at lot during the annotation
> process.
> 
> cheers,
> 
> Keith
> 


-- 
BioJava Consulting LTD - Support and training for BioJava
http://www.biojava.co.uk



More information about the Biojava-l mailing list